John Poelstra said the following on 05/16/2007 02:09 PM Pacific Time:
At power up box hangs (keyboard lights blinking) about 50% of the time
while it appears to be starting the network. Running on a Dell
Precision 470. Weird thing is that I power the box off and it boots
fine the next time.
uname -a
Linux yardsale 2.6.21-1.3149.fc7 #1 SMP Fri May 11 12:12:11 EDT 2007
i686 i686 i386 GNU/Linux
Anyone else seeing this?
No information in /var/log/messages and I don't have a serial cable handy.
John
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=240992
Still seeing this problem. Appears to be hanging at "network start" section of boot routine (watching the graphical boot screen).
# uname -a
Linux yardsale 2.6.21-1.3175.fc7 #1 SMP Mon May 21 11:35:59 EDT 2007 i686 i686 i386 GNU/Linux
I performed a more scientific (?) study this time, starting at a complete power off state each time (as opposed to rebooting when I had a successful boot). What is interesting is that it failed almost every other time until it started failing every time. Boot failed 66% of the time.
Boot Attempt Result
============ =========
1 HANG
2 boot
3 HANG
4 boot
5 HANG
6 boot
7 HANG
8 boot
9 HANG
10 HANG
11 HANG
12 boot
13 (no more, I need my primary desktop to do work)
